Trees at the side of 45, block the sun from the solar pannels and are also blocking the guttering all the time, has to get them cleared 3 times a year, the sap from the tree is super slippy. one of the trees are overhanging front garden

  • Your report has been forwarded to the appropriate department. Please note, we are only able to inspect trees that are dead, damaged, diseased or causing a physical obstruction as a priority. All general tree maintenance work requests that are causing no risk of harm to people or property will be dealt with as resources allow.
